Single answerA company is hosting a critical application on a vSphere cluster. The application consists of two virtual machines (VMs) that need to communicate with each other with minimal latency. Additionally, the company requires that these two VMs always reside on the same host to ensure optimal performance. Which type of rule should be configured in VMware vSphere DRS to meet this requirement?
- A
VM-VM Anti-Affinity Rule
- B
VM-VM Affinity Rule
- C
VM-Host Affinity Rule
- D
Host Group Rule
Show answer and explanation
Correct answer: B
Explanation
To meet the requirement of keeping two VMs together on the same host to minimize latency, a VM-VM Affinity Rule should be configured in VMware vSphere DRS. This rule ensures that the specified VMs will always reside on the same host, fulfilling the company's need for optimal performance and communication between the VMs.
- A. Incorrect.
A VM-VM Anti-Affinity Rule ensures that specified VMs are not placed on the same host, which is the opposite of the requirement in this scenario.
- B. Correct.
A VM-VM Affinity Rule ensures that specified VMs are always placed on the same host. This aligns with the requirement to minimize latency and keep the VMs together.
- C. Incorrect.
A VM-Host Affinity Rule is used to specify which VMs should run on specific hosts or groups of hosts. This does not address the requirement of keeping the two VMs on the same host.
- D. Incorrect.
A Host Group Rule is used to group ESXi hosts for specific purposes, and it does not apply to the scenario where two VMs need to stay on the same host.
